Q: How do I get a locker in the changing rooms?

A: Lockers at Thornegate Mills are assigned on your first day by the workplace team. Yours will have your surname taped inside the door. Bring your own padlock if you prefer, otherwise the built-in keypad works fine. To set it up the first time, enter the default code below.

badge for haduf-bafop: bdg-O-78

**Ticket: Config drift in query planner on Larkspur cluster**

Welcome aboard — if you're triaging this, here's the context. Since the Quillbase 4.2 rollout, the query planner on the Larkspur staging cluster has been choosing sequential scans where it used index paths before. The cause is drift: staging was hand-edited during the Meridian incident and never reconciled with the baseline. Before you change anything, compare against production. The current staging values are as follows.

deployment values, yadug-bawif:
[framir]
team = pelox
access_code = ac_a38ab2
owner = tamion.julael
host = framir.tolvaqlabs.test
port = 11211
peer = tammir.zemvargrid.local
salt = 2215ef03
pin = 1541

# Quillhopper Queue Migration — Environments

Quillhopper replaces the homegrown job queue that previously lived inside the Ledgerbarn monolith. Each environment runs its own broker; nothing is shared across them, which simplifies draining during deploys. Dev uses an in-memory backend, staging mirrors production topology at reduced capacity, and production runs the full three-broker setup. Future maintainers should treat staging as the source of truth for tuning experiments. Production currently operates with the following configuration.

settings of bawif-fawif:
ralix:
  log_level: warn
  metrics_host: metrics.ralix.tolvaqsys.internal
  pool_size: 32

Release note for plugin authors: the Gullwick autocomplete index got slow after 4.2 because suggestion scoring now runs per-keystroke. Workaround: batch your custom providers and respect the debounce hint. A proper fix lands next patch. Pin your plugins against the hotfix build identified below.

pipeline stamp: htk9_ce63042d9